Slovenia – A Green Destination Celebrated on World Bee Day
Celebrate World Bee Day with Slovenia at Expo Osaka. The aim of this event is to present Slovenia as a green, boutique, and diverse tourist destination to Japanese media representatives and invited guests. Taking place on the symbolic occasion of World Bee Day – a United Nations-recognized international day initiated by Slovenia – the event uses this meaningful context to highlight the country’s broader values: sustainability, cultural richness, and authentic hospitality. The objective is to raise awareness, spark media interest, and reinforce Slovenia’s image as a destination where nature, tradition, and innovation coexist in harmony.
